Yuan Mei is a highly accomplished molecular neuroscientist with broad-ranging experience in both academic and industry settings. After completing a B.A. in Cognitive Neuroscience from Rice University, Mei went on to earn a PhD in Molecular and Cellular Neuroscience from the internationally renowned Massachusetts Institute of Technology. Throughout their career, Mei has been an author on a number of high-impact publications, showcasing their expertise in molecular biology, genetic engineering, and assay development.
Mei has held positions as a postdoctoral research fellow at the University of California, San Diego-School of Medicine and as a Scientist at Denali Therapeutics and Alector LLC. In these roles, Mei has honed a collaborative leadership style and spearheaded projects focused on antibody and small molecule drug discovery.
In addition to their extensive experience in the lab, Mei is currently pursuing training in bioinformatics and machine learning. This additional training will provide Mei with even more tools for success as they continue to make an impact in the field of molecular neuroscience.
